Delve into the realm of West Coast synthesis within Ableton Live with the Op Oloop Y Coast Synth 1, a Max4Live device that pays homage to the legacy of Don Buchla. Designed by OpOloop, this device aims to replicate the renowned complex oscillators and the Low Pass Gate (LPG), providing a unique sonic experience reminiscent of West Coast synthesis. Op Oloop Y Coast Synth 1 features sine, triangle, saw, and square waveforms, which intertwine with overtones and a wavefolder effect before reaching the emulated LPG. Users can tailor their sound using various filters, and the device's architecture is displayed in an open window for easy understanding. With 22 presets ready for exploration and full modulation capabilities through Ablefree's native LFOs, the synth maintains a straightforward approach while delivering complex timbres. Although currently monophonic, there's a hint that a polyphonic evolution may be on the horizon. The device, compatible with Live 11 and Max 8, is available for purchase, extending an invitation to producers to experiment with West Coast synthesis within their Ableton Live environment.

Dive into the depths of old school dub with the M4L Dub Siren 2.2, a Max4Live device by egnouf designed to craft that classic siren sound pivotal to the genre. With its simple yet powerful interface, you can manipulate pitch to create distinctive tones, choose from 12 pre-defined presets or design your own, and exploit its unique features like PULSE & Sine modulations, a FIRE/FLAM function, and a Gate for stutter effects, all without the distraction of built-in delay or reverb. The latest update now allows for seamless parameter mapping to any external MIDI controller and hands-on triggering with your mouse or keyboard, adding a tactile dimension to your live performances or studio sessions. Perfect for both synth enthusiasts and DJs, all running on Ableton Live 10.1.18 and Max 8.1.5, this free instrument device, available for non-commercial use under a Creative Commons license, brings the unmistakable dub siren sound to your production arsenal. Explore the sonic playground of glitches and unexpected sonic textures with the Clumsy Delay 1.0 Max4Live device, a quirky and inventive tool for audio manipulation within Ableton Live. Authored by sakuogt, this simple delay effect transcends its basic functions by allowing users to tweak parameters to create a range of glitch noises. Its distinctive 'dif' control introduces a difference in delay time between channels, enabling a width in the clicks and pops that can resemble the Haas effect. Although a new addition with just 26 downloads, Clumsy Delay 1.0 shows promising potential for producers seeking to infuse their tracks with unique auditory quirks, from subtle textures to full-blown glitchy breakdowns, all achievable in the hands of those adventurous enough to experiment with its controls in a Live session.
